Posting hole-by-hole scores to GHIN can easily be done when the following conditions are met:
Player's GHIN number and Last Name must be in the Event/League Roster. If you imported players from GHIN, then that necessary step is complete. If the players in the event or league came from your master roster, make sure all the players have their correct GHIN number and Last Name in the master roster.
Imported courses from the USGA CRD must be compliant with the USGA CRD database. For more details about verifying your course, Click Here.
Hole-by-hole scores are entered for each hole played.
To post 9-hole scores, 9 scores must be entered. To post 18-hole scores, 10 scores must be entered. Note: GHIN will calculate the adjusted gross score for each player and can be seen in the "Score Posting Report."
The option to post scores is enabled in the Event/League Profile. Go to League/Event > Event/League Profile > Handicap Settings. Make sure "Post Scores to GHIN" is selected (as shown below). Now you are ready to start posting scores.

Posting Scores:
After a round is complete and hole-by-hole scores are entered, follow these instructions to post scores:
Go to Rounds > Post Scores to GHIN.
Select who you'd like to post scores for. Use the check box on the left to select the players or click "Check All" to select all players. You can also filter players by custom field to select specific players.
Select the score type (e.g., home, away, etc).
Click "Post Scores".
Posting Status:
If a player's score was successfully posted, a green GHIN will appear to the right of their name. If a player's score is not successfully posted, a red GHIN will appear. Hover over the red to see the reasoning.

Posting Results:
To view the full posting results, go to Rounds > See Posting Results. The time of posting will be listed, as well as the summary of successful and failed posts (as shown below). To download the posting report into a PDF, click "Print Full Report".
